HandyControl导航控件使用教程:TabControl、SideMenu等5种导航方案
【免费下载链接】HandyControl 项目地址: https://gitcode.com/gh_mirrors/han/HandyControl
想要为你的WPF应用程序设计优雅高效的导航系统吗?🚀 HandyControl提供了多种强大的导航控件,让界面布局变得更加简单直观。本文将为你详细介绍5种核心导航方案,帮助你快速构建现代化的应用界面。
HandyControl是一个功能丰富的WPF UI控件库,专门为.NET开发者设计,提供了大量美观实用的控件组件。其中导航控件是其重要特色之一,能够满足不同场景下的导航需求。
1. TabControl选项卡控件:多标签页管理利器
TabControl是HandyControl对WPF原生选项卡控件的增强版本,具备更多实用功能。通过简单的配置,你就能创建出功能丰富的标签页导航系统。
核心特性:
- 支持动画效果,切换更加流畅
- 可拖动调整标签顺序
- 显示关闭按钮,方便用户操作
- 支持溢出处理和滚动功能

2. SideMenu侧边菜单:优雅的垂直导航方案
SideMenu专为左右布局的界面设计,提供清晰的层级结构导航。它目前支持垂直布局,未来可能会扩展到任意布局。
主要功能:
- 自动选中首项,提升用户体验
- 多种子项展开模式可选
- 支持图标和文本的组合显示
3. Pagination页码条:数据分页的最佳选择
当数据量过大时,Pagination能够有效地将数据分解成多个页面,让用户浏览更加便捷。
配置选项:
- 自定义最大页数和每页数据量
- 设置当前页码和显示间隔
- 可选跳转功能,快速定位目标页

4. StepBar步骤条:引导式操作流程
StepBar非常适合需要分步完成的操作场景,比如注册流程、订单提交等。它能够清晰地展示当前进度,引导用户完成整个操作。
5. Drawer抽屉控件:侧滑式导航体验
Drawer提供了一种现代化的侧滑导航方式,可以容纳更多的功能选项,同时保持界面的简洁性。
快速上手配置方法
要使用这些导航控件,首先需要安装HandyControl。在你的项目中添加引用后,就可以在XAML中直接使用这些强大的导航组件。
基础配置示例:
<hc:TabControl IsAnimationEnabled="True" ShowCloseButton="True"
IsDraggable="True" Width="800" Height="300">
<hc:TabItem Header="首页">
<!-- 首页内容 -->
</hc:TabItem>
<hc:TabItem Header="设置">
<!-- 设置内容 -->
</hc:TabItem>
</hc:TabControl>
最佳实践建议 💡
- 选择合适的导航控件:根据应用场景和界面布局选择最合适的导航方案
- 保持一致性:在整个应用中使用统一的导航风格
- 考虑用户体验:确保导航操作直观易懂
- 响应式设计:考虑不同屏幕尺寸下的导航显示效果
总结
HandyControl的导航控件为WPF开发者提供了完整的解决方案,无论是简单的标签页还是复杂的层级导航,都能找到合适的组件。通过本文介绍的5种导航方案,你可以快速构建出既美观又实用的应用界面。
记住,好的导航设计能够显著提升用户体验,让你的应用在众多软件中脱颖而出!🌟
【免费下载链接】HandyControl 项目地址: https://gitcode.com/gh_mirrors/han/HandyControl
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



